Collecting a race pack
You will be able to collect your race pack at the Race Office located in the Palace of Culture and Science (Pałac Kultury i Nauki, Plac Defilad 1)
Race Office opening hours:
September 24th (Friday) from 12:00 PM to 08:00 PM
September 25th (Saturday) from 10:00 AM to 08:00 PM
Remember – following current restrictions, face masks must be worn at the Race Office at all times.
IMPORTANT! The Race Office will be closed on Sunday (the day both runs take place)
If you are collecting your race pack personally, you will be asked to show your photo ID. If you want someone else to collect your race pack, you should print and sign your participation card, available in the second part of September upon logging in to your profile and under tab “Your Runs”. The signed card along with a copy of your photo ID should be shown upon collecting your race pack by someone else.

Getting there/ parking
There’s a very limited number of parking spots near the venue. We highly recommend choosing public transport, ie. arriving at Dworzec Gdański Metro Station. Remember that on the day of the event, you can use public transport for free within Zone 1 and upon showing your race bib.
We would like to remind you that on September 26, the 43rd Warsaw Marathon (start at 8:00) and the 15th Warsaw Half Marathon (start at 12:00) will also be held. When planning your arrival, check the organizational changes in public transportation and traffic- all that you can find in our Road Information.

Deposit Office
The Deposit Office will be located near the Start/ Finish Zone (Sanguszki street) and open from 04:00 PM to 06:00 PM. You will locate the truck that will accept your deposit, by the number visible on your race bib. You will need your race bib to collect your deposit after the race.
